Hobson explained that Win or Lose has all the humor and heart of a Pixar feature film, but with a different type of storytelling. When working on Toy Story 4, Hobson and Yates realized that they had pretty different interpretations of how their creative meetings went, so they used these differing interpretations to develop the idea of an animated series revolving around one event, but with each character having their own conflicts surrounding the event. The series will consist of 20 minute episodes. "It's not so much about softball as it is a comedy about love, rivalry, and the challenges we all face in our struggles to win at life," Pixar's Chief Creative Officer Pete Docter stated. Carrie Hobson and Michael Yates were announced to be creating, writing and directing from an idea they conceived, while David Lally was announced to be producing the project. On December 10, 2020, during Disney's Investor Day meeting, Pixar announced an original series titled Win or Lose for its parent company Disney's streaming service, Disney+ it is Pixar's first long-form animated series, as well as the first not to be based upon an existing property, as most of Pixar's television projects are from the short-form. Win or Lose follows a co-ed middle school softball team called the Pickles in the week leading up to their big championship game. Win or Lose is scheduled to premiere on Disney+ in late 2023. The animation appears to shift, distinguishing itself further from usual fare in each episodes, with Brendan Beesley, Brandon Kern and Tom Zach as head of animation. Win or Lose draws inspiration from the conversations between Hobson and Yates, who would have very different reactions to the exact same events upon working on Toy Story 4 (2019). Pixar was developing the long-form original series for Disney+ in December 2020, during Disney's Investor Day, with Hobson and Yates on board. Will Forte is set to star as lead character Coach Dan. The series revolves around a co-ed softball team at middle school named the Pickles in the week leading up to their big championship game, with each episode showing the perspective of each member in the same events for each reflected in a unique visual style. The studio's first original long-form animated series, it was written and directed by Hobson and Yates from an idea they conceived, and produced by David Lally. Win or Lose is an upcoming American computer-animated television series created by Carrie Hobson and Michael Yates and produced by Pixar Animation Studios for the streaming service Disney+.
